Senior Marketing Analyst, Hospitality
Work Mode: Onsite
Location: Onsite 4 -Kohler, WI
Opportunity
We are seeking a highly analytical and strategic SeniorMarketing Analyst to serve as the engine behind Kohler Hospitality'smarketing decision-making and performance optimization. This role isresponsible for converting complex data across our entire ecosystem intostrategic recommendations-from creative production efficiency to multi-channelcampaign ROI and guest lifetime value.
The ideal candidate bridges technical analytics, predictivemodeling, and executive-level storytelling. Beyond reporting on pastperformance, you will proactively uncover growth opportunities, leadcross-functional optimization strategies, and build scalable reportingarchitectures that empower our leadership and marketing teams to act with speedand precision. This high-impact role provides direct analytical governancesupporting digital, creative, social, PR, media agency, and lifecycle marketingfunctions.
Specific Responsibilities
Strategic Full-Funnel Analytics & Performance Governance
  • Multi-Channel Strategy: Lead the tracking, cross-channel attribution, and deep-dive analysis of KPIs across all marketing channels, including Digital Ads (Search/Social), Web (Adobe Analytics), Organic Social, PR, Email, and SMS.
  • Creative Operations Optimization: Partner directly with the Creative Manager to audit creative hours versus business output. Analyze resource utilization trends to guide talent allocation toward high-priority, high-converting luxury business segments.
  • Executive Dashboards & Architecture: Architect, deploy, and maintain automated, enterprise-level real-time dashboards that establish a single source of truth for marketing performance across Kohler Hospitality.

Advanced Insights, Optimization & Forecasting
  • Advanced Attribution Modeling: Build and continually refine multi-touch attribution models to evaluate the end-to-end guest journey, identifying key conversion drivers across digital and on-property touchpoints.
  • Experimental Strategy & Testing: Lead test design and post-campaign analysis for web landing pages, email workflows, and creative variations, instituting a rigorous A/B and multivariate testing culture to continuously drive incremental revenue.
  • Audience Intelligence & Retention: Analyze customer segmentation, CRM data, and guest behavior to pinpoint growth opportunities, optimize RFM (Recency, Frequency, Monetary) models, and elevate guest retention through lifecycle automation.
  • Strategic Recommendations: Present actionable findings directly to marketing leadership and business unit leads to influence annual marketing planning, media spend allocations, and promo strategy.

Data Governance, Automation & Tech Stack Leadership
  • Workflow & Analytics Automation: Identify and execute opportunities to automate manual reporting processes, eliminating administrative overhead and establishing seamless analytics pipelines.
  • Data Integrity & Tagging Governance: Serve as the subject matter expert for tracking architecture, maintaining strict oversight over Google Tag Manager (GTM), Adobe Analytics tags, UTM taxonomy, and naming conventions to ensure data integrity.
  • Tech Stack Ownership: Act as the primary analytical lead for marketing intelligence tools and platforms, ensuring full technical integration, vendor compliance, and maximum ROI on software investments.

Skills/Requirements
Experience: 5+ years of progressive experience in analytics, business intelligence, or digital strategy, ideally within hospitality, premium retail, or multi-outlet environments.
Education: Bachelor's degree in Marketing Analytics, Business Administration, Statistics, Economics, Computer Science, or a related quantitative field.
Technical Proficiency:
  • Mastery of Adobe Analytics, Google Analytics, and Tag Management systems (GTM) or similar.
  • Expertise in BI & visualization platforms (Power BI, Tableau, or Looker).
  • Advanced Excel/Google Sheets skills (complex formulas, modeling, macros/VBA).
  • Familiarity with SQL, Python, or R for database querying and data manipulation is strongly preferred.

Channel & Media Expertise: Technical understanding of performance metrics across paid media platforms, CRM/email platforms, SMS workflows, and PR monitoring tools.
Communication & Influence: Proven ability to synthesize complex, multi-layered data sets into clear, executive-level narratives and compelling visual decks for non-technical stakeholders.
Core Competencies:
  • Strategic Vision: The ability to look past immediate metrics and understand long-term business and revenue impacts.
  • Precision & Rigor: An uncompromising commitment to data accuracy, methodological soundness, and governance.
  • Agility & Leadership: Comfortably navigating between high-level brand strategy and granular creative/channel data while mentoring junior analytical partners.
